How much do music production intern j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for music production intern in Riverside, CA is $21.22,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.10 and $24.74 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Music Production Intern position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Music Production Intern, you need a basic understanding of music theory, audio editing, and recording principles, often backed by relevant coursework or personal projects. Familiarity with digital audio workstations (DAWs) like Pro Tools, Logic Pro, or Ableton Live, as well as basic knowledge of studio hardware, is highly beneficial.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to communicate and collaborate effectively are essential soft skills for this role. These strengths enable interns to contribute meaningfully in fast-paced studio environments and adapt to the technical and creative demands of music production.

What is a Music Production Intern job?

A Music Production Intern assists producers, engineers, and artists in various stages of music creation. Responsibilities may include recording, editing, mixing, organizing sessions, and handling administrative tasks. Interns often gain hands-on experience with digital audio workstations (DAWs), microphones, and studio equipment. This role provides valuable exposure to the music industry and helps develop technical and creative skills.

What kinds of projects and day-to-day tasks do Music Production Interns typically work on?

Music Production Interns often assist with setting up and breaking down studio equipment, editing audio tracks, organizing session files, and supporting engineers or producers during recording sessions. Day-to-day tasks may include updating project documentation, managing sample libraries, handling simple mixing tasks, and ensuring the studio environment runs smoothly. Interns might also get opportunities to shadow professionals during live recordings or contribute creative ideas during brainstorming sessions. This hands-on exposure helps build essential technical, organizational, and teamwork skills for a future career in music production.
